Domestic tourism may not offer lifeline needed for Thailand tourism recovery, says GlobalData
A number of Thailand’s top ten source markets such as the US and India also remain badly affected by COVID-19. This suggests that the international tourism recovery will be slow for the destination as lack of spending and arrivals from its main contributors may cause further damage in the foreseeable future
Deal Activity in travel & tourism sector declined by 11.3% during September
The number of private equity, partnership, venture financing, debt offerings, and mergers and acquisition (M&A) deals shrank by 41.7%, 33.3%, 15.8%, 10.5%, and 3.2% during September compared to the previous month, respectively, while equity offerings deal volume increased by 4%.

Decline in revenue-passenger kilometer, high cash burn rate compel airlines to cut jobs, says GlobalData
Airlines across the globe are going through the most severe crisis that they have ever encountered. Compared to the impact of SARS on the aviation industry, the monetary impact of COVID-19 is expected to be 45-50 times higher
Top Chinese airline companies show signs of recovery, says GlobalData
Shortly after the slight dip in the first quarter ended 31 March 2020 (Q1 2020), the top airline stocks in China have been on the rise, mainly on account of the Chinese borders opening, growing domestic demand as well as the rise of Yuan and declining oil prices

South Korean aviation sector shows positive signs in Q2 but full recovery will take time, says GlobalData
Korean Air reported a year-on-year operating profit of KRW148.5bn in Q2 on account of surge in cargo sales. On annual basis, the pandemic affected the company’s revenue by 44%
